      From: mxg77@po.cwru.edu              Ehhhhh, fine? I enjoy musicals, although I can't stand Rent and I didn't pick       up most of the other style references in this (or what the title may be       playing on). But it's been a while since a truly great Simpsons musical       showcase, and even if all the        ages worked out, I do not buy for a second that all these Springfielders were       theater nerds in high school (if ever), but I suppose consistent character       histories and characterizations were buried long ago. This also had the       annoying instant plot        resolution problem, just not at the end, because we still had to sit through       the show. Welcome to season 33.              There's a new Fox logo at the end now, looking like the previous one but       reading 20th Television Animation. Seems to be on all the relevant shows.              Legend of television and more Ed Asner, who guest starred in AABF21 (just a       few months before Y2K, as it happens), died on August 29th, and I was       surprised to see no dedication to him tonight. Wedging dedications into       episode repeats has been        disturbingly common lately, but unless I completely missed it, there wasn't       one in that night's QABF05 repeat, and there were no other network Simpsons       airings until tonight, apart from QABF06 (see below). I really expected to see       one tonight! What        happened to "better late than never"?                     Summer repeat roundup       -QABF14 airing 2 (June 6) lost the dedication to Olympia Dukakis       -QABF13 airing 2 (June 20) moved Maurice LaMarche from Also Starring to his       usual place in Guest Starring       -ZABF22 airing 2 (August 1) gained a dedication to Jackie Mason (with a still       from 8F05) but lost the Alex Trebek dedication from its original airing       -ZABF20 airing 3 (August 15) was compressed to 21 minutes       -QABF01 airing 3 (August 22) dropped the Larry King dedication that had only       been on airing 2       -QABF06 airing 3 (September 19) reinstated the Marc Wilmore dedication from       airing 1 that was left out of airing 2 (but the audio fades may be different)                     By the way, for all the good posting *here* will do (but why stop now?): I've       brought the sax solo and opening sequences pages up to date (through season       31) on The Simpsons Archive and will be getting more documents done when I can.              --- SoupGate-Win32 v1.05        * Origin: you cannot sedate... all the things you hate (1:229/2)    |
